10/01/2002, 18:43
|
| | Fecha de Ingreso: enero-2002
Mensajes: 5
Antigüedad: 22 años, 10 meses Puntos: 0 | |
Re: Esto me esta matando!!! Sorry :-p ahora me di cuenta que el evento era con teclado, para crear el efecto, no uses onenterFrame, usa keyDown, y luego una comprobacion de que tecla pulsa el usuario, Key.getCode compara que tecla estas pulsando al ser la 39 es la flecha derecha, cada vez que se pulse la tecla derecha disminuira -5 de alpha hasta llegar a 0 y luego sube +5 cada vez.
onClipEvent (keyDown) {
if (Key.getCode() == 39){
a = _root["blachu"+c]._alpha;
if (a>=100) {
i = 1;
}
if (a<=0) {
i = 0;
}
if (i == 1) {
_root["blachu"+c]._alpha = _root["blachu"+c]._alpha-5;
}
if (i == 0) {
_root["blachu"+c]._alpha = _root["blachu"+c]._alpha+5;
}
}
}
Pues este es el codigo, lo probé y va bien. Creo que era esto lo que preguntabas, ha el mensaje de antes es de dos frames, con uno tambien funciona :-p
Suerte, ah y gracias por lo de la pagina, esta un poco descuidada :( tengo que ponerme con ella.
Saludos!
----------------------------------------
Javimp - <a href='ir.asp?http://www.subflash.com' target='_blank'>http://www.subflash.com...</a> |